Forum - Questions sur Access - Faire un zoom sur un champ en VBA


 2 membres
Connectés : ( personne )

le 13/08/2019 12:07
par possible924
 
visiteur

Bonjour à tous,

Dans un formulaire, est possible de faire un zoom sur un contrôle avec le raccourcis clavier Shift + F2 mais les utilisateurs de mon application ont tendance à oublier cette facilité.

Je souhaiterais donc, placer un bouton près du contrôle pour ouvrir le zoom par VBA. J'ai bien essayé par SebdKeys, mais ça crée des perturbations.

Merci par avance pour votre aide

Pierre

  
Réponse n° 1
--------
le 13/08/2019 16:34
par 3Stone
 
Administrateur

Bonjour,

Tu peux mettre "sur réception du focus"  de la zone de texte :

   DoCmd.RunCommand acCmdZoomBox

mais dans ce cas, la box s'ouvre à chaque fois.

Ou alors, sur clic d'un bouton à coté... mais dans ce cas il faut ajouter un setfocus.

   NomZoneDeTexte.SetFocus
   DoCmd.RunCommand acCmdZoomBox

Voilà.

Cordialement,
Pierre (3Stone)

  
Réponse n° 2
--------
le 13/08/2019 17:29
par possible924
 
visiteur

Excellent, merci et bonne soirée

Pierre

  
sujet actif   sujet clos   Important!   Nouveau  
Rectifier message   Clôturer sujet   Remonter sujet